如何进行数据可视化中的数据过滤?

在当今这个大数据时代,数据可视化已成为展示和分析数据的重要手段。通过数据可视化,我们可以直观地了解数据的分布、趋势和关系,从而为决策提供有力支持。然而,在进行数据可视化之前,对数据进行有效过滤是至关重要的。本文将详细介绍如何进行数据可视化中的数据过滤,帮助您更好地展示和分析数据。

一、数据过滤的意义

在进行数据可视化之前,对数据进行过滤可以有效去除无用信息,提高数据质量,从而更准确地反映数据的真实情况。以下是数据过滤的几个主要意义:

  1. 提高数据质量:通过过滤掉异常值、重复值等无效数据,提高数据质量,确保可视化结果的准确性。

  2. 突出重点:针对特定问题或目标,对数据进行过滤,可以突出关键信息,便于观察和分析。

  3. 提高效率:过滤掉无用数据,可以减少数据处理的复杂性,提高工作效率。

  4. 避免误导:有效过滤数据,可以避免因错误数据导致的误导性结论。

二、数据过滤的方法

  1. 数据清洗

数据清洗是数据过滤的第一步,主要包括以下内容:

(1)异常值处理:通过统计学方法,如箱线图、3σ原则等,识别并处理异常值。

(2)重复值处理:识别并删除重复数据,确保数据的唯一性。

(3)缺失值处理:根据实际情况,对缺失值进行填充或删除。


  1. 数据筛选

数据筛选是根据特定条件对数据进行过滤,以下是一些常见的数据筛选方法:

(1)条件筛选:根据特定条件(如数值范围、类别等)筛选数据。

(2)分组筛选:根据数据分类(如地区、时间等)筛选数据。

(3)交叉筛选:结合多个条件进行筛选,以获取更精确的数据集。


  1. 数据转换

数据转换是对原始数据进行加工处理,使其更适合可视化分析。以下是一些常见的数据转换方法:

(1)数据归一化:将不同量纲的数据转换为相同量纲,便于比较。

(2)数据标准化:消除量纲影响,使数据更适合统计分析。

(3)数据聚合:将多个数据点合并为一个数据点,便于观察趋势。

三、案例分析

以下是一个简单的案例分析,展示如何进行数据可视化中的数据过滤:

假设我们有一份数据集,包含某城市居民的收入、消费和年龄信息。为了分析不同年龄段居民的收入与消费关系,我们需要对数据进行过滤:

  1. 数据清洗:删除异常值、重复值和缺失值。

  2. 数据筛选:筛选出20-60岁之间的居民数据。

  3. 数据转换:将收入和消费数据进行归一化处理。

经过数据过滤后,我们可以得到一个更精确的数据集,便于进行可视化分析。

四、总结

数据可视化中的数据过滤是确保可视化结果准确性的关键步骤。通过对数据进行清洗、筛选和转换,我们可以提高数据质量,突出关键信息,为决策提供有力支持。在实际操作中,我们需要根据具体问题选择合适的数据过滤方法,以确保数据可视化效果的最佳化。

猜你喜欢:微服务监控